Output 100d668dd3fe72fa03f33f16ed48f53bb5d6f648759cd7536dc29a36b6653e59:1

value
198860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b15364a5de3476f90130dd29dc266c6d5000d8a2 OP_EQUAL
address
3HrdRknjznnZ6XzUs1arQv8ch9xCjrrDhw
transaction
100d668dd3fe72fa03f33f16ed48f53bb5d6f648759cd7536dc29a36b6653e59
spent
true